powered by simpleCommunicator - 2.0.61     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Получение URL-адреса
3 сообщений из 3, страница 1 из 1
Получение URL-адреса
    #34952607
Mazai-XZ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Доброго времени суток!
Господа, подкинтье идейку, пожалуйста!
Вопрос вот в чём. Есть форма в ВБ проекте. на форме текстБокс (или комбобокс) не важно.
Проект запущен. Далее, открываем Броузер (InternetExplorer), в котором в строке адреса набито допустим http:\\my_page.ru
Задача: Требуется, чтоб после нажатия кнопки на форме проекта в текстбоксе появлялся этот самый http:\\my_page.ru
Т.е. задача в "выдёргивании текущего УРЛа" из броузера и вставка его в текстовое поле
Приблизительно text1.text = brouser.URL

Благодарю за внимание!!!
...
Рейтинг: 0 / 0
Получение URL-адреса
    #34958837
Belkin
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Подключаешь 2 библиотеки mshtml.tlb и shdocvw.dll и пишешь код

Код: plaintext
1.
2.
3.
4.
5.
6.
7.
8.
9.
10.
11.
12.
13.
14.
15.
Option Explicit

Dim ShellWindows As New ShellWindows
Dim WithEvents WebBrowser As WebBrowser
Dim WithEvents Document As HTMLDocument
Private Sub Form_Load()

Dim ShellWindow As Object

    For Each ShellWindow In ShellWindows
        If TypeOf ShellWindow.Document Is HTMLDocument Then
            Set Document = ShellWindow.Document
            MsgBox Document.url
        End If
    Next
End Sub

-----------
Андрей.
...
Рейтинг: 0 / 0
Получение URL-адреса
    #34970795
Mazai-XZ
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Ну просто нечеловеческое огромнейшее спасибо!!! Всё работает как часы! Пасибо! ))))
...
Рейтинг: 0 / 0
3 сообщений из 3, страница 1 из 1
Форумы / Visual Basic [игнор отключен] [закрыт для гостей] / Получение URL-адреса
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]